What is the Tokyo Culture Creation Project?

The Tokyo Culture Creation Project is a project executed by the Tokyo Metropolitan Government and the Tokyo Metropolitan Foundation for History and Culture, in collaboration with various arts and cultural organizations and art NPOs. The Project aims to create Tokyo’s unique art and culture, and nurture children through the arts.

The project includes events and festivals such as theater, music, traditional performing arts and fine arts, art programs realized through active collaboration between citizens of Tokyo and artists, human resources development projects that link the city with art, and experiential programs for children.

Tokyo is a city where Japanese traditional arts renowned around the world such as Ukiyoe, Japanese wood block prints, and Kabuki drama have been preserved, nurtured and can still be enjoyed firsthand today. In recent years, Tokyo is not only a base for the arts of a wide range of artists, but also creating all kind of forms of pop culture, typified by Japanese animation which has been spread throughout the world.

By promoting the creative activities and their achievements originated by artists with the citizens of Tokyo, the Tokyo Culture Creation Project aims to present image of Tokyo as “a city for the creation of art and culture” not only in Japan, but across the globe strongly.

Logo Concept

Logo Concept
The logo is designed in the motif of the leaves of the ginkgo, a tree that stands as a symbol of Tokyo. The design epitomizes the ties between people and between children and adults, and creates an image of the earth. Different shapes and colors portray the diversity of peoples and cultures, which brings out the joyful encounters among people. Together with the shape of a star embodied in the center, the entire design symbolizes a future full of dreams and hopes.

TRADITIONAL PERFORMING ARTS
Experience space for “wa (Japan/harmony)” in a Japanese garden.  “Tokyo Grand Tea Ceremony ”

This open-air tea ceremony at Hama-rikyu Gardens is open to anyone who would like to experience Japanese traditional culture.

A festival of traditional performing arts in Tokyo that everyone can enjoy  “Tokyo Traditional Performing Arts Festival”

Tokyo presents a festival of traditional performing arts where everybody can discover something to enjoy. The festival includes top-class performances of traditional performing arts in different genres such as traditional Japanese music, traditional Japanese dance and rakugo.

Nurturing of children
A genuine traditional Japanese theater to children “Traditional Performing Arts for Kids”

Children will receive lessons first-hand from top artists in Noh play, classical Japanese dance, and later perform on the big stage.

New music created naturally “Music and Rhythms: Tokyo Kids”

In this workshop, under the direction of world-class performers, children will create music with instruments they will make themselves from bamboo.

Creation of stage work that makes children leading part “Performance Kids Tokyo”

Professional artists will provide workshops at schools and in public auditoriums. Together, elementary school and junior high school students will create an original stage play in which children will play the leading characters.
